Landscape Installer Jobs in Osceola, IN

A Landscape Installer is a professional in the landscaping industry responsible for executing landscape designs. Their duties involve planting trees, flowers, and shrubs, installing irrigation systems, and laying sod and mulch. They may also build hardscape elements such as patios, walkways, and retaining walls. To ensure the longevity and health of the installed landscapes, these professionals also perform maintenance tasks such as pruning, fertilizing, and watering, following specific procedures and schedules.

Important skills for a Landscape Installer include physical stamina, attention to detail, and knowledge of horticulture. They must also possess good communication skills to interact with clients and team members. Some Landscape Installers may hold certifications such as the Certified Landscape Technician (CLT) or Certified Professional Horticulturist (CPH), demonstrating their expertise in the field. Prior to becoming a Landscape Installer, individuals may have roles such as a Landscape Laborer, Gardener, or Grounds Maintenance Worker, where they can gain relevant hands-on experience and knowledge.
